Regulatory Environment and Policy Impact on Japan Home Blood Glucose Meter Market
Japan’s regulatory framework for medical devices is stringent, emphasizing safety, efficacy, and data privacy. The Pharmaceuticals and Medical Devices Agency (PMDA) oversees device approval, requiring comprehensive clinical data and compliance with international standards such as ISO 13485. Recent policy shifts favor digital health innovations, with streamlined approval pathways for connected devices and telehealth solutions.
Reimbursement policies are evolving to include digital therapeutics and remote monitoring, incentivizing manufacturers to develop compliant solutions. Data security regulations, including the Act on the Protection of Personal Information (APPI), mandate robust cybersecurity measures. Policymakers are also promoting aging-in-place initiatives, encouraging the adoption of home monitoring devices. Navigating this complex regulatory landscape demands strategic planning, local expertise, and proactive engagement with authorities to ensure timely market access and sustained growth.
